Before we dive into the specifics of the L7, it's important to understand the inherent relationship between Litecoin and Dogecoin. While Dogecoin is a standalone cryptocurrency, its proof-of-work mechanism is based on the Scrypt algorithm, the same algorithm used by Litecoin. This means that hardware designed for Litecoin mining, like the L7, can also be effectively used for Dogecoin mining, albeit with some minor adjustments in configuration. This shared algorithmic foundation is precisely why the L7 is attracting attention from the Dogecoin community; it offers a potentially cost-effective way to participate in the Dogecoin mining process.

Beyond the raw performance metrics, the L7's energy efficiency is a crucial consideration. The cost of electricity is a significant factor in mining profitability. A rig with high energy consumption can quickly negate any gains made from increased hash rates. The L7's advertised power consumption figures should be scrutinized carefully, and comparisons with existing miners should be made to assess its true energy efficiency. Independent testing and user reports on power consumption will be vital for assessing its viability for different geographical locations and energy pricing structures. This information is particularly important for Dogecoin miners who might operate on tighter budgets compared to those mining more established cryptocurrencies.
